Dachangshan Bridge
大长山大桥
Shanyangzhen, Yunnan, China
240 feet high / 73 meters high
509 foot span / 155 meter span
2002
One of the few arches on the G56 Expressway in Yunnan Province, the Dachangshan Bridge is located along the G56 in a remote region of western China. The concrete bridge is located where the G56 begins to descend into the deep Lancangjiang River valley at kilometer 447.
